Microphones: The Heart of Your Recording Setup
The microphone is arguably the most important piece of equipment for a voice actor. It's responsible for capturing your voice and converting it into an electrical signal that can be recorded. There are several types of microphones to choose from, each with its own strengths and weaknesses.
Types of Microphones:
- Condenser Microphones: These are generally the most popular choice for voice acting due to their sensitivity and ability to capture a wide range of frequencies. They require phantom power (usually 48V) from an audio interface or mixer. They're often more detailed and accurate than dynamic microphones, making them suitable for capturing the nuances of your voice. Condenser mics are also more fragile than dynamic mics.
- Dynamic Microphones: These are more robust and less sensitive than condenser microphones, making them a good choice for recording in noisy environments or for voice actors with loud voices. They don't require phantom power. Dynamic mics are less detailed and sensitive, but they are often more forgiving and durable, making them a good option for beginner voice actors or for recording in less-than-ideal environments. A classic example is the Shure SM58, known for its reliability and affordability.
- USB Microphones: These microphones connect directly to your computer via USB and don't require an audio interface. They are a convenient and affordable option for beginners, but they typically don't offer the same level of quality or flexibility as dedicated microphones and interfaces. They are a good starting point, but most voice actors will eventually upgrade to a dedicated microphone and interface.
- Ribbon Microphones: Ribbon microphones are known for their warm, smooth sound. They are delicate and expensive, but they can add a unique character to your voice. They are less commonly used for voice acting than condenser or dynamic microphones, but they are a valuable option for voice actors looking for a specific sound.
Polar Patterns:
A microphone's polar pattern describes its sensitivity to sound from different directions. Understanding polar patterns is crucial for minimizing unwanted noise and maximizing the quality of your recordings.
- Cardioid: This is the most common polar pattern for voice acting. It picks up sound primarily from the front of the microphone, rejecting sound from the sides and rear. This helps to minimize room noise and focus on your voice.
- Omnidirectional: This pattern picks up sound equally from all directions. It's not ideal for voice acting in most situations, as it will capture a lot of room noise.
- Bidirectional (Figure-8): This pattern picks up sound from the front and rear of the microphone, rejecting sound from the sides. It can be useful for recording interviews or duets.

Audio Interfaces: Connecting Your Microphone to Your Computer
An audio interface is a device that converts the analog signal from your microphone into a digital signal that your computer can understand. It also provides phantom power for condenser microphones and preamps to amplify the signal from your microphone. Choosing the right audio interface is essential for achieving high-quality recordings.
Key Features to Consider:
- Number of Inputs/Outputs: Determine how many inputs and outputs you need. For most voice actors, one or two inputs are sufficient.
- Preamps: Look for an interface with high-quality preamps that will amplify your microphone signal without adding noise or distortion.
- Sample Rate and Bit Depth: These settings determine the resolution of your audio recordings. A sample rate of 44.1 kHz or 48 kHz and a bit depth of 16-bit or 24-bit are generally sufficient for voice acting.
- Connectivity: Most audio interfaces connect to your computer via USB. Thunderbolt interfaces offer faster transfer speeds but are typically more expensive.

Headphones: Monitoring Your Performance
Headphones are essential for monitoring your voice while recording and for mixing and editing your audio. Choosing the right headphones can help you hear your voice accurately and identify any problems with your recording.
Types of Headphones:
- Closed-Back Headphones: These headphones provide excellent isolation, preventing sound from leaking out and being picked up by your microphone. They are the best choice for recording.
- Open-Back Headphones: These headphones offer a more natural and spacious sound, but they don't provide as much isolation. They are better suited for mixing and editing.
Key Features to Consider:
- Comfort: You'll be wearing your headphones for extended periods, so comfort is essential.
- Frequency Response: Look for headphones with a flat frequency response to ensure accurate sound reproduction.
- Impedance: Choose headphones with an impedance that is compatible with your audio interface or headphone amplifier.

Acoustic Treatment: Improving Your Recording Environment
Even with the best equipment, your recordings can suffer if your recording environment is not properly treated. Acoustic treatment helps to reduce reflections and reverberation, resulting in a cleaner and more professional sound. This is especially important if you are recording in a small or untreated room. Treating your room will make the biggest difference in your overall sound. It is often more beneficial than upgrading equipment.
Types of Acoustic Treatment:
- Acoustic Panels: These panels absorb sound and reduce reflections.
- Bass Traps: These traps absorb low-frequency sounds and reduce bass buildup.
- Diffusers: These devices scatter sound and create a more natural-sounding environment.
- Reflection Filters (Portable Vocal Booths): These are semi-circular shields that sit behind the microphone and absorb some of the room's reflections.
DIY Acoustic Treatment:
You can also create your own acoustic treatment using materials like:
- Blankets: Hanging blankets on walls can help to absorb sound.
- Furniture: Soft furniture like couches and chairs can also help to absorb sound.
- Bookshelves: Bookshelves filled with books can act as diffusers.

Accessories: The Finishing Touches
In addition to the core equipment, there are a few accessories that can further enhance your recording setup:
- Microphone Stand: A sturdy microphone stand is essential for positioning your microphone correctly.
- Pop Filter: A pop filter reduces plosives (the popping sounds caused by P and B sounds).
- Shock Mount: A shock mount isolates the microphone from vibrations, reducing noise.
- XLR Cables: Use high-quality XLR cables to connect your microphone to your audio interface.

Troubleshooting Common Issues
Even with the best equipment, you may encounter some issues during your recordings. Here are some common problems and how to fix them:
- Noise: Noise can be caused by a variety of factors, including electrical interference, background noise, and poor microphone technique. Try to identify the source of the noise and address it.
- Distortion: Distortion can be caused by overloading your microphone or audio interface. Reduce the gain on your microphone or audio interface to prevent distortion.
- Low Volume: If your recordings are too quiet, increase the gain on your microphone or audio interface.
- Echo: Echo is caused by sound reflections in your recording environment. Use acoustic treatment to reduce reflections and eliminate echo.
